The 300,000 acre Hatcher Pass Management Area primarily consists of mountainous terrain in the Talkeetna Mountain Range that climb from the 1000 ft. valley floor to summits higher than 6,000 ft. Due to the mountainous terrain, most off-trail snowmobiling in Hatcher Pass requires at least a moderate level of skill and experience, but novices can ride on the 22 miles of groomed and marked trails.
